internal static void Serialize(object obj, BinaryTokenStreamWriter stream, Type expected) { var envelope = (RequestEnvelope)obj; SerializationManager.SerializeInner(envelope.Target, stream, typeof(ActorPath)); SerializationManager.SerializeInner(MessageEnvelope.Serializer(envelope.Message), stream, typeof(byte[])); }
internal static void Serialize(object obj, BinaryTokenStreamWriter stream, Type t) { var envelope = (NotificationEnvelope)obj; SerializationManager.SerializeInner(envelope.Sender, stream, typeof(ActorPath)); SerializationManager.SerializeInner(MessageEnvelope.Serializer(envelope.Message), stream, typeof(byte[])); }